Padres bring 5-game win streak into matchup with the Giants
San Diego Padres (79-68, second in the NL West) vs. San Francisco Giants (62-86, fourth in the NL West)
San Francisco; Saturday, 4:05 p.m. EDT
PITCHING PROBABLES: Padres: Michael King (10-9, 3.00 ERA, 1.17 WHIP, 144 strikeouts); Giants: Cesar Perdomo (0-0, 0.90 ERA, 0.80 WHIP, eight strikeouts)
LINE: Padres -158, Giants +129; over/under is 7 1/2 runs
BOTTOM LINE: The San Diego Padres seek to extend a five-game win streak with a victory over the San Francisco Giants.
San Francisco has gone 36-37 in home games and 62-86 overall. The Giants have hit 167 total home runs to rank ninth in the NL.
San Diego has a 33-39 record in road games and a 79-68 record overall. The Padres have the ninth-best team ERA in MLB play at 3.89.
The teams meet Saturday for the 12th time this season. The Padres lead the season series 7-4.
TOP PERFORMERS: Rafael Devers leads the Giants with 73 extra base hits (36 doubles, a triple and 36 home runs). Christian Koss is 11 for 32 with three home runs and five RBIs over the last 10 games.
Manny Machado ranks third on the Padres with 48 extra base hits (22 doubles and 26 home runs). Fernando Tatis Jr. is 13 for 41 with a double, a triple, three home runs and five RBIs over the last 10 games.
LAST 10 GAMES: Giants: 5-5, .249 batting average, 4.74 ERA, outscored by four runs
Padres: 7-3, .263 batting average, 3.24 ERA, outscored opponents by nine runs
